M-Net shows taking a production break

Popular US series’ on M-Net and M-Net Edge continue to entertain viewers via Express from the US. Mirroring US schedules means that people can watch their favourites very close to the US, with no spoilers, no waiting and within 24 hours of the US airing. And while the channels always want our viewers to be on top of the #conversation, there will always be annual production breaks in the latter part of the year.

Production breaks are when viewers’ favourite TV shows take a break on-air in the US: this means there will be no new episodes broadcast on M-Net (ch.101) or M-Net Edge (ch.102) —not forever, just for a little while.

While there are some exceptions to the rule, the US production breaks usually vary between one and three weeks. When these series’ return to television screens, viewers will once again be able to watch a brand new episode every week.

Should the production break last between 1-2 weeks, the channel (M-Net or M-Net Edge) would then repeat previous episodes. When production breaks go on for more than 2 weeks, a replacement show will be scheduled on the channels.
